About the aluminum
2024 aluminum plate is a typical duralumin in al-cop-magnesium system with reasonable composition and good comprehensive properties. The alloy is produced in many countries and is the most widely used duralumin. The characteristics of the alloy are: high strength, a certain degree of heat resistance, can be used for working parts below 150℃. The strength of 2024 alloy is higher than that of 7075 alloy at temperatures above 125℃. The formability is better in hot state, annealing state and new quenching state, and the effect of heat treatment is remarkable, but the heat treatment process is strict. Poor corrosion resistance, but with pure aluminum coating can be effectively protected; It is easy to crack when welding, but it can be welded or riveted with special technology. Widely used in aircraft structures, rivets, truck wheels, propeller components and other structural parts.
2024 aluminum plate is widely used in aircraft structure (skin, frame, rib, frame, etc.), rivets, missile components, truck wheels, propeller components and other various structural parts.
Chemical composition of 2024 aluminum plate
Si: 0.5%; Iron: 0.5%; Copper: 3.8-4.9; Manganese: 0.3-0.9; Magnesium: 1.2-1.8; Cr: 0.10; Zinc: 0.25; Titanium: 0.15; Other: 0.15; Aluminium: others;
Aluminum is a silver-white light metal, relatively soft, density 2.7g/cm3, melting point 660.4℃, boiling point 2467℃, aluminum and aluminum alloys have many excellent physical properties, has been very widely used. Aluminum has good reflection performance of light, reflecting ultraviolet light is stronger than silver, the purer aluminum is, its reflection ability is better, and the method of vacuum aluminum plating is commonly used to make high-quality mirrors. Vacuum aluminized film combined with polysilicon film becomes a cheap and lightweight solar cell material. Aluminum powder can maintain a silvery luster, often used to make paint, commonly known as silver powder. Pure aluminum conducts electricity very well, second only to silver and copper. In the electric power industry, it can replace part of copper for wires and cables. Aluminum is a good conductor of heat. It can be used to make various heat exchangers, heat dissipating materials and civil cookers in industry. Aluminum has good ductility, can be drawn into a fine wire, rolled into a variety of aluminum products, but also can be made into thinner than 0.01mm aluminum foil, widely used in packaging cigarettes, candy, etc.. Aluminum alloy has some better properties than pure aluminum, which greatly expands the application range of aluminum. For example, pure aluminum is soft, when a certain amount of copper, magnesium, manganese and other metals are added to aluminum, the strength can be greatly improved, almost equivalent to steel, and the density is small, not easy to rust, widely used in aircraft, cars, trains, ships, artificial satellites, rockets manufacturing. At -196 ° C, some steel is as brittle as glass, while some aluminum alloys increase in strength and toughness, making them cheap and lightweight cryogenic materials that can be used to store liquid oxygen and hydrogen for rocket fuel.
